This week, Olympique de Marseille celebrates its 125th anniversary. We discuss it with the children of franceinfo junior and Bruno Blanzat, sports journalist and commentator of OM matches for Ici Provence (formerly France Bleu).

From Monday to Thursday, the franceinfo junior program analyzes current events from a children's perspective, featuring presenter Jules de Kiss on franceinfo radio.

On Friday, May 2, 2025, a match bringing together football stars will take place to celebrate the 125th anniversary of the Olympique de Marseille football club. This is an opportunity to discuss it on Franceinfo Junior with the CM2-C students of the Louise Michel school in Vigneux-sur-Seine, near Paris. To answer their questions: Bruno Blanzat, sports journalist and commentator of OM matches for Ici Provence (formerly France Bleu Provence).
